NORTH KOREA FIRED SEVERAL BALLISTIC MISSILES INTO THE SEA. (PHOTO).

 North Korea fired several ballistic missiles into the sea Monday, South Korea’s military said, hours after South Korean and U.S. troops kicked off their large annual combined drills, which the North views as an invasion rehearsal.  South Korea’s Joint Chiefs of Staff said the missile firings, North Korea’s fifth missile launch event this year, were detected from the North’s Hwanghae province but gave no further details such as how far they flew.  Earlier Monday, the South Korean and U.S. militaries began their annual joint military exercises, which are scheduled to last 11 days. The Freedom Shield command post exercise began after the South Korean and U.S. militaries paused live-fire training while Seoul investigates how two of its fighter jets mistakenly bombed a civilian area during a warm-up drill last week.  The drills' start drew the condemnation of nuclear-armed North Korea, which issued a government statement calling the exercises a “dangerous provocative act...

Armed Men Invade Burial Ceremony In Ebenebe, Anambra State, Kill Over 20.




Armed men suspected to be cultists on Saturday, 26th February, 2022, invaded a burial ceremony in Ebenebe, Awka North Local Government Area of Anambra State, killing about 20 persons.

The burial was that of Ozo, a suspected leader of a cult, and while the corpse of Ozo was lying in state, some suspected cultists arrived the scene and sacked mourners, shooting at them.

Anambra residents are now living in fear over the rising violence in the state. Many are hopeful that incoming Governor, Professor Charles Chukwuma Soludo will prioritise security of life and property in the state.
